Step-by-Step Setup Instructions
Setting up your Orbi device usually consists of several straightforward steps. Begin by connecting the Orbi router to your modem using an Ethernet cable. Power on both devices and wait for the lights to start blinking. After this, use the Orbi app or access the web interface through a browser to configure your network settings. Choose a unique SSID and ensure your network is secured with a strong password. This initial configuration will assist in creating an effective network environment.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Despite the reliability of Orbi systems, users may encounter several common issues. If you notice slow internet speeds, ensure that your firmware is up to date. For connectivity problems, verify that all connections are secure and properly configured in the system settings. Restarting the Orbi router and extending the placement of satellites can also dramatically improve performance.
